Php tutorial for beginners step by step with example. Happy birthday make an online birthday card on a webpage. Fpdf is a php class which allows to generate pdf files with pure php. Fpdf is a php class which allows to generate pdf files with pure php, that is to say without using the pdflib library. Further, by use of a library called pdflib, php can be used to generate pdf files. Its code can be embedded into html code which simplifies web page creation. I tried working with dompdf mpdf and other libraries but if the document is simple and doesnt feature a lot of designing either of two are good. Php is a server side scripting language that is embedded in html. The php hypertext preprocessor php is a programming language that allows web developers to create dynamic content that interacts with databases. Python plays an essential role in network programming.
This concise and accessible textbook will enable readers to quickly develop the working skills necessary to solve computational problems in a serverbased environment, using html and php. Excerpt from homepage polyorb aims at providing a uniform solution to build distributed applications. The library can be used with most programming languages. In this post i will explain you how to generate a simple pdf file from your mysql database using php. Php library allows developers to take full advantage of object oriented programming in php. To fix this item automatically, select tagged pdf on the accessibility checker panel, and then choose fix from the options menu. Java connector information on the jdbc driver for mariadb. June 4, 2019 latest pdflib version covered in this document. Mar 27, 2016 i tried working with dompdf mpdf and other libraries but if the document is simple and doesnt feature a lot of designing either of two are good. For this purpose we will use the popular php library fpdf which will enable us to generate the pdf file with the content and ourput format we desire. Italic used for emphasis, or as a substitute for an actual name or value. Jun 25, 2012 if youre looking to create powerpoint files using php theres a good chance youll end up using the phppowerpoint library. When it comes to running your python scripts on web, you have to.
It is powerful enough to be at the core of the biggest blogging system on the web wordpress. The following tutorial explains how to determine if the gd library is enabled on your php server, and how you might be able to turn this on. Php is a popular generalpurpose scripting language that is especially suited to web development. Having just spent a few days converting a complex pdf report to pptx format using this library, i learned a few things that i thought i should share with the world. The one that worked the fastest and most efficiently was the html to pdf class on php classes but eventually this easysw remote html to pdf service in the html to pdf class stopped serving pdf files from html submissions as the easy software closed their business. Nov 03, 2015 how to disableenable gd library on xampp. Programming in html and php coding for scientists and. With crossplatform compatibility, stability, flexibility and speed, php is the preferred choice for serverside web development and other. Teach, learn, and make with raspberry pi raspberry pi. Application programming interfaces mariadb knowledge base. Polymorphism is a greek word that means manyshaped and it has two distinct aspects. In this article we have compiled a list of best php libraries that will help developers to do number of things easily and. Courier bold italic designates comments within code samples.
Ajaxbrowser scripting reference download pdf ajaxbrowser scripting reference. Composer is a really great package in php for installing php libraries. In order to achieve that youll need to practice strict organization and consistency with your coding. Above libraries are php classes that wrap the html and build the pdf so. Researchers have created a proofofconcept exploit that would enable bad actors to target a severe vulnerability in the php programming language behind. Before you can turn html into pdf, you need to integrate the html to pdf library into your java application or use the pdfreactor web service. Normally, we teach on khan academy using videos, but here in programming land, we teach with something we call talkthroughs.
We will go through creating a form that can be filled out and using php, grab. Combining the power of reactive programming and php, one of the most widely used languages, will enable you to create web applications more pragmatically. This is a quick guidetutorial to learning socket programming in php. Building against the bundled libzip is discouraged, but still possible by adding withoutlibzip to the configuration. This tutorial will help you understand the basics of php and how to put it in practice.
You need to install this on your server after that you can write code to generate pdf. At run time, objects of a derived class may be treated as objects of a base class in places such as method parameters and collections or arrays. When this polymorphism occurs, the objects declared type is no longer identical to its runtime type. Tcpdf is on the first place of this top as it is the most easy to use php library to create pdf s and however, the most complete and extense as it doesnt require executable files as everything works with plain php. Php modules and extensions on shared hosting servers. Join garrick chow for an indepth discussion in this video enable pdf forms for acrobat reader, part of acrobat dc. A talkthrough is like a video, but its actually interactive you can pause at any time if you want to play with the code yourself, and you can spinoff if you want to make your own version of what we made. How to disableenable gd library on xampp learn php web. How to generate dynamic pdf file using tcpdf in php youtube. Rasmus lerdorf unleashed the first version of php way back in 1994. Using nonlatin unicode japanese, hindi, arabic, etc. It is usable from php via system or a similar call. The process of programming what we saw with javascript or toy is like reality, but very small figure out what to do start with a broad specification break into smaller pieces that will work together spell out precise computational steps in a programming language.
This means that all the functions described in the pdflib reference manual are. It is deep enough to run the largest social network facebook. Web development php scripting language examples php sample codes create website with php script examples learn how to make a website. Recall the programming language used to create your own calculations in acrobat. Ada programminglibrariesdistributedpolyorb wikibooks. This tutorial shows you how to do both, and help up your php proramming potential. Using macro settings to enable macros in workbooks outside trusted locations. Applications of php programming language invensis technologies.
For example, the parameter username would be replaced by an actual users name. Interested in programming since he was 14 years old, carlos is. Jan 31, 2012 the one that worked the fastest and most efficiently was the html to pdf class on php classes but eventually this easysw remote html to pdf service in the html to pdf class stopped serving pdf files from html submissions as the easy software closed their business. You might want to use php on raspberry pi for several reasons.
This means that all the functions described in the pdflib reference manual are supported by. Apr 12, 2015 php library allows developers to take full advantage of object oriented programming in php. If you need something more powerful though, you should look at the imagine library. Mar 06, 2015 further, by use of a library called pdflib, php can be used to generate pdf files. Whether you use windows, linux or macos the installation of the converter package is quick and easy. This library of interfaces creates a standard api for certain kinds of builtin functionality, allowing your classes to interact with the php engine in a much more seamless manner. Single composer is usually all there is to installing a php library, whether it is a pdf library, logger or any other tool. Learn how to install php and db2r on system itm, and understand how to port a mysql application to db2 on i5osr. For a brief overview and definition of the language elements used, refer to annex d, pseudo. Generate pdf files using php scripts with tcpdf, build pdf files dynamically with. This chapter will give you an idea of very basic syntax of php and very important to make your php foundation strong. Aug 08, 2019 in this post i will explain you how to generate a simple pdf file from your mysql database using php. The pseudo code can easily be mapped to conventional scripting and programming languages. Php is an opensource scripting language that is mainly used to create dynamic web pages.
Visit our projects site for tons of fun, stepbystep project guides with raspberry pi htmlcss python scratch blender. Open source php class for generating pdf documents. Most functions are similar in names, parameters and output. Creating pdf on the fly with the pdflib library maintainers rainer schaaf lead details. How to create a pdf using php simple tutorial 2019 youtube. Although it requires xml wellformedness of the input.
Fpdf requires no extension except zlib to enable compression and gd for gif support. The condition for a successful integration is that the programming language is able to execute functions from an external library. Single composer is usually all there is to installing a php library, whether it. Web development tutorial enabling the gd library setting. By default this php ldap module is not enable in xampp as most web servers are not using ldap as their database or directory. Add mailbox via php download zip an example of adding a mailbox in a php page. The php parsing engine needs a way to differentiate php code from other elements in the page.
Provisioning example download zip an script example application that uses the mailenable web application provisioning library. Is there any directives i have to enable to execute the code. Creating powerpoint files with php yet another programming blog. Getting started with the raspberry pi set up your raspberry pi and explore what it can do. Php is basically used for developing webbased software applications. Learn how to take static pdf documents and turn them into interactive forms with acrobat dc. Enable tagging in the application in which the pdf was authored, and recreate the pdf. Advanced php programming sams publishing,800 east 96th street,indianapolis,indiana 46240 usa developers library a practical guide to developing largescale web sites and applications with php 5 george schlossnagle. This tutorial is aimed to get you started with python cgi programming. Btw dynapdf also be used with many other programming languages like python, visual foxpro or vb script, also if no predefined interface is available for such programming languages. However unlike c, socket programs written in php would run the same way on any os that has php installed. The condition for a successful integration is that the programming language is. This can facilitate the creation of an online invoicing system where an htmldriven invoice is created in pdf format.
How to build a good reusable php library with organization. But in case you want a great designed document and dont want to frustrate yourself with the css supp. To install with composer, simply require the latest version of this package. Imageworkshop is developed to make easy the most common cases for manipulating images in php. Activate pdf library in php windows 32 bit stack overflow.
With a bit of work, however, you can teach raspberry pi to understand other languages, including php. Abstract this manual describes the php extensions and interfaces that can be used with mysql. However, php can also be used to build powerful commandline applications just like bash, ruby, python, and so on there are many commnad line php pdf library available at the moment. A site designer can jump between php and html without inserting tons of. Php originally stood for personal home page, but it now stands for the recursive initialism php.
For help with using mysql, please visit the mysql forums, where you can discuss your issues with other mysql. Flying saucer takes xml or xhtml and applies css 2. Garrick chow shows how to add a variety of interactive form fieldseverything from text and check boxes to radio buttons and list boxesand how to trigger actions with buttons. Powershell reference download pdf powershell reference for managing the mailenable platform, postoffices, mailboxes, domains, etcnet programming reference download pdf.
Dynapdf is a pdf library for windows, linux, unix, max os x, ios and android. Php reactive programming by martin sikora overdrive. Details that are not essential for human understanding of the algorithm are omitted or represented as calls to local methods of the app instance. In this article we have compiled a list of best php libraries. For the creation of pdf files, i need to activate the prebundled pdf library referred here in my php by editing the configuration file. To use ldap support in php served under windows you need to have three libraries. This means that all the functions described in the pdflib reference manual are supported by php 4 with exactly the same meaning and the same parameters. Mar 23, 2018 php is typically used with a web server like apache or nginx to serve dynamic content. Fpdf requires no extension except zlib to enable compression and. If youre looking to create powerpoint files using php theres a good chance youll end up using the phppowerpoint library.
Php 6mysql programming for the absolute beginner andy harris course technology ptr a part of cengage learning australia brazil japan korea mexico singapore spain united kingdom united states. Cisco router configuration commands lists how to enable and disable interfaces, add ip addresses to interfaces, enable rip or igrp and set passwords cisco router show commands handy show commands to check on the status of interfaces cisco router basic operations covers getting into and out of different modes. In this video, i will explain and demonstrate how to use nonlatin unicode characters in pdf, created by php tcpdf library. So the code does not need any platform specific changes mostly.
Best open source pdf generation libraries for php our. Php scripting language examples happy codings php sample. Learning programming on khan academy article khan academy. Analyze php source code and apply a custom set of rules by building a cli tool. One of the things youll need for a successful future in programming is a great reusable library of code. Programming languages more than just a pdf library. Php started out as a small open source project that evolved as more and more people found out how useful it was. Net mysql mobile excel css apache matlab game development data analysis processing big data data science powershell. This php pdf tutorial uses mpdf and some basic php coding. Api guide download pdf api guide for mailenable programming interfaces. Convert html to pdf, html to pdf converter pdfreactor. Snappy is a php5 library that allows you to take snapshots or pdfs of urls or html documents.
In a default php installation, the gd library should already be enabled. The importance of learning by example as opposed to simply learning by copying is emphasized through. Use the withlibzipdir configure option to use a system libzip installation. Severe php exploit threatens wordpress sites with remote. Phptpoints free online php tutorial has heaps of php interview question and wellrun interview question with answer associated to core php, cake php, codeigniter, mysql, joomla etc. Reactive programming helps us write code that is concise, clear, and readable. Fast, flexible and pragmatic, php powers everything from your blog to the most popular websites in the world.
1070 1652 1435 1496 320 284 10 667 946 431 557 1571 56 8 184 59 750 1402 1156 409 283 1133 747 1543 139 897 875 1615 857 1017 1071 1553 1483 1487 1396 614 629 597 364 1155 572 672 812 343 1423 1417